Considerable challenges face the school finance community relating to the implementation of such concepts as equity, adequacy, accountability, and efficiency within a policy environment. Although each of these concepts focuses on a specific aspect of public education, in practice they are often linked. Although more work is needed to clarify these standards, it is already evident, as is pointed out in this volume, that the kinds of dual service systems that have been created for general and special education students can be better integrated in order to improve outcomes related to all four of these important concepts. Special education has become a vital component of the nation's overall education system. It is essential that future work to address fiscal policy challenges include the special needs of children with disabilities along with those of all children. The purpose of this book is to contribute to a fuller incorporation of special education fiscal policy concerns into the mainstream of the education finance literature and fiscal policy. The goal of Education For All, set by the United Nations at the 1990 Jomtien (Thailand) Conference and adopted by heads of state at the World Summit for Children in the same year, confronts all of us with the fundamental challenge of including children with disabilities in the education system of all nations. The aim of this book is to record, analyse and celebrate positive signs of growth and development in the field of special needs education but with particular reference to children with significant disabilities. The special education theme was selected for the 1993 edition of The World Yearbook of Education in synchrony with the ending of the UN Decade of Disabled Persons, 1983 to 1992.

This yearbook contains information on federal policy actions, state policy, important reports, statistical data on exceptional students served and personnel employed; and directory listings of key offices, officials, and organizations concerned with special education. Generally, the yearbook covers reports issued from July 1987 through June 1988. General information papers are provided on: federal legislation; judicial decisions; the executive summary of the Tenth Annual Report to Congress on the Implementation of the Education of the Handicapped Act, 1988; the status of handicapped children in Head Start programs; Special Education in Canada (1988); and the future of research in special education. The second section provides United States statistics on exceptional children served. Section III includes annual awards. Directory information is provided in Section IV including: United States Congress Committees related to the handicapped; Office of Special Education Programs; the Council for Exceptional Children; United States Directors of Special Education; United States Coordinators of Programs for the Gifted and Talented; and Canadian Senior Government officials in Special Education. Fifty-eight tables provide a variety of statistical data concerning children served, their handicapping conditions, the educational environments utilized, reasons for exiting the educational system, and number of anticipated services needed.
